If any of you have ever read Illusions: Adventures of a Reluctant Messiah , you're familiar with this. If not, read the book. These are things to think about - things to meditate on. I think I'll post one of these every once in a while. If you want them all, ask me.
I'd love it if you'd post your thoughts and responses to them. Here's the first one:A cloud does not know why it moves in just such a direction and at such a speed, it feels an impulsion....this is the place to go now. But the sky knows the reason and the patterns behind all clouds, and you will know, too, when you lift yourself high enough to see beyond horizons.. |
